    1831 (MDCCCXXXI) was a common year starting on Saturday of the Gregorian calendar and a common year starting on Thursday of the Julian calendar, the 1831st year of the Common Era (CE) and Anno Domini (AD) designations, the 831st year of the 2nd millennium, the 31st year of the 19th century, and the 2nd year of the 1830s decade As of the start of 1831, the Gregorian calendar was 12 days ahead

    On the evening of August 21–22, 1831, an enslaved preacher and self-styled prophet named Nat Turner launched the most deadly slave revolt in the history of the United States Over the course of a day in Southampton County, Turner and his allies killed fifty-five white men, women, and children as the rebels made their way toward Jerusalem (now Courtland) Less than twenty-four hours after the

    Classroom Resources > A Biography of America > 8 The Reform Impulse > 8 2 The Events of 1831 The Events of 1831 January 1 Garrison publishes the Liberator William Lloyd Garrison publishes the first issue of the Liberator and emerges as the leader of the abolitionist movement in the United States

    Events from the year 1831 in the United States President: Andrew Jackson (D-TN) Vice President: John C Calhoun (D-SC) Chief Justice: John Marshall (VA) Speaker of the House of Representatives: Andrew Stevenson (D-VA) Congress: 21st (until March 4), 22nd (starting March 4) January 1 – William Lloyd Garrison begins publishing The Liberator, an antislavery newspaper, in Boston, Massachusetts
